Timing for popular Newbury venues

Timing is everything in our part of Berkshire. When I advise couples about Timing for popular Newbury venues, I map routes from Thatcham, Tadley or Hungerford and add padding for school runs, market days and race meetings. That extra 10–15 minutes often saves a day.

Suggested pick-up windows for common Newbury-area venues
Venue or area Suggested pick-up before ceremony Notes
Newbury Racecourse 30–45 minutes Allow extra for race-day traffic and parking marshals.
Kennet and Avon Canal towpaths 20–30 minutes Great for photos; arrange a short stop if you want canal-side shots en route.
Country houses around Lambourn / Hungerford 35–50 minutes Narrow lanes and farm traffic can add time; we route in advance.

Accessibility and special support

Weddings are for everyone. Our conversation about Accessibility and special support is practical: step heights, wider door openings, space for carers or mobility aids, and discreet driver assistance. Guests travelling from Whitchurch or Tadley often need extra reassurance — we build that into the booking.

  • Pre-arranged assistance at pick-up and drop-off points
  • Vehicle options with easier access for reduced mobility
  • Quieter cars and flexible timing for nervous or elderly passengers

Driver communication on the day

Clear, calm talk with your driver is one of those small things that makes the day feel effortless. We always recommend a quick run-through with the chauffeur an hour before the first pick-up: route, contact numbers, any parking quirks at venues and who'll be stepping into the car first. That live briefing is why couples travelling from Thatcham to Newbury feel relaxed rather than rushed.

Vehicle choices by wedding style

People in Newbury often ask "which car suits my theme?" Here's a straightforward guide that respects personality over trend. If you're aiming for nostalgia, a restored saloon from the classic era beats an anonymous modern silhouette. If you want sleek city-chic for photos around the town centre, a modern luxury saloon or a Maybach-style interior works better.

Best vehicle choices for different wedding moods in and around Newbury
Wedding style Suggested vehicle Why it works here
Vintage & Heritage Classic saloon or vintage Rolls-style Matches historic venues and looks timeless on canal-side photographs.
Contemporary & Minimal Modern luxury saloon or discreet executive car Smooth lines for town-centre photos and a quiet ride for nerves.
Bold & Fun Stretch limo or statement sports car Creates a theatrical arrival at venues like Donnington or country houses nearby.
